"use strict"; /** * @module adaptive-expressions */ /** * Copyright (c) Microsoft Corporation. All rights reserved. * Licensed under the MIT License. */ Object.defineProperty(exports, "__esModule", { value: true }); exports.Take = void 0; const expressionEvaluator_1 = require("../expressionEvaluator"); const expressionType_1 = require("../expressionType"); const functionUtils_1 = require("../functionUtils"); const returnType_1 = require("../returnType"); /** * Return items from the front of an array or take the specific prefix from a string. */ class Take extends expressionEvaluator_1.ExpressionEvaluator { /** * Initializes a new instance of the [Take](xref:adaptive-expressions.Take) class. */ constructor() { super(expressionType_1.ExpressionType.Take, Take.evaluator, returnType_1.ReturnType.Array | returnType_1.ReturnType.String, Take.validator); } /** * @private */ static evaluator(expression, state, options) { let result; const { value: arr, error: childrenError } = expression.children[0].tryEvaluate(state, options); let error = childrenError; if (!error) { if (Array.isArray(arr) || typeof arr === 'string') { let start; const startExpr = expression.children[1]; ({ value: start, error } = startExpr.tryEvaluate(state, options)); if (!error && !Number.isInteger(start)) { error = `${startExpr} is not an integer.`; } if (!error) { start = Math.max(start, 0); result = arr.slice(0, start); } } else { error = `${expression.children[0]} is not array or string.`; } } return { value: result, error }; } /** * @private */ static validator(expression) { functionUtils_1.FunctionUtils.validateOrder(expression, [], returnType_1.ReturnType.Array | returnType_1.ReturnType.String, returnType_1.ReturnType.Number); } } exports.Take = Take; //# sourceMappingURL=take.js.map
